Share of newborns vaccinated against tuberculosis in Croatia
Croatia: Share of newborns vaccinated against tuberculosis was 96.0% in 2024. ▬ Flat
Share of newborns vaccinated against tuberculosis in Croatia, 1992–2024
Source: WHO & UNICEF (2025); UN, World Population Prospects (2024) – processed by Our World in Data. Measured in %.
Analysis
Croatia recorded 96.0% for share of newborns vaccinated against tuberculosis in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.0% on the previous year and down 2.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of newborns vaccinated against tuberculosis in Croatia peaked at 99.0% in 1995 and was at its lowest, 92.0%, in 1992.
Croatia ranks 62nd of 166 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 97.1% | 92.0% | 99.0% | 8 |
| 2000s | 98.4% | 97.0% | 99.0% | 10 |
| 2010s | 98.6% | 98.0% | 99.0% | 10 |
| 2020s | 97.0% | 96.0% | 98.0% | 5 |
